    Overview Of BMW Motorcycles

    BMW motorcycles combine engineering excellence, performance, and style, appealing to various riders. The lineup ranges from the agile G 310 series to the powerful K 1600 touring models. Each bike features unique characteristics tailored to specific riding needs.

    Types of BMW Motorcycles

    1. Adventure Bikes: Designed for on-road and off-road use, models like the R 1250 GS are perfect for exploring diverse terrains.
    2. Sport Bikes: Models such as the S 1000 RR focus on high speed and agility, catering to those who crave adrenaline.
    3. Touring Bikes: The K 1600 GTL offers comfort for long-distance travel, packed with features like heated seats and advanced navigation systems.
    4. Cruisers: The R nineT series emphasizes classic design and a relaxed riding position, appealing to those who appreciate a vintage look.

    Key Features

    • Engine Performance: Most BMW motorcycles utilize flat-twin or inline engines that deliver power efficiently, ensuring responsive acceleration.
    • Technology: Advanced electronics like ABS, traction control, and ride modes enhance safety and performance.
    • Comfort: Ergonomic designs cater to rider comfort during extended journeys, with adjustable seating and wind protection.

    Price Range Of BMW Motorcycles

    Understanding the price range of BMW motorcycles helps you find the right model for your budget.

    Entry-Level Models

    Entry-level models typically start around $5,000. Examples include the BMW G 310 R and the G 310 GS. These bikes offer lightweight performance and agility, ideal for beginner riders. You’re looking at features like a 313 cc engine and an approachable seat height.

    Mid-Range Models

    Mid-range models fall between $10,000 and $20,000. The BMW F 750 GS and F 850 GS exemplify this category. These motorcycles provide a balance of performance and versatility, featuring larger engines—around 853 cc—better suited for daily commuting and weekend adventures. Comfort and advanced tech, such as ride modes, enhance the overall riding experience.

    High-End Models

    High-end models range from $20,000 to over $25,000. The BMW R 1250 GS Adventure and K 1600 GT are prime examples. These bikes deliver premium features, including powerful 1,254 cc engines, sophisticated suspension systems, and cutting-edge electronics. You’ll enjoy comfort for long-distance trips along with the capability to tackle various terrains.

    Factors Affecting The Price

    Several factors affect the price of a BMW motorcycle. Understanding these elements helps you make a more informed decision.

    Features And Specifications

    Features and specifications play a significant role in pricing. Higher displacement engines typically command higher prices. Advanced technology, such as ABS and connectivity options, also influences costs. For example, the BMW K 1600 GT, equipped with a powerful 1649cc engine, sits at a premium due to its performance and features. Comparatively, the G 310 R, with a 313cc engine, remains more budget-friendly but offers less power and fewer amenities.

    Location And Dealership

    Location and dealership significantly impact pricing. Dealerships in urban areas may charge more due to higher demand and overhead costs. Additionally, regional regulations affecting taxes and fees can raise the total price. Visit multiple dealerships to compare prices and explore regional promotions. Online resources can also help you find reputable dealers in your area.

    Seasonality And Promotions

    Seasonality often affects motorcycle pricing. Manufacturers commonly offer discounts during the off-season, typically winter months, to clear inventory for new models. Check for promotional events during the spring or summer riding season; dealers might provide incentives, financing options, or package deals to boost sales. Taking advantage of these promotions can result in considerable savings when purchasing your BMW motorcycle.

    Comparison With Other Motorcycle Brands

    Comparing BMW motorcycles with other brands reveals the unique position they hold in the market. You’ll find various factors influencing price and features across different manufacturers.

    Similar Pricing Models

    BMW motorcycles often align with brands like Honda, Yamaha, and Kawasaki in the price range. For instance:

    Brand Entry-Level Model Price Range
    BMW G 310 R $5,000 – $6,000
    Honda CB500F $6,000 – $7,000
    Yamaha YZF-R3 $5,300 – $5,600
    Kawasaki Ninja 400 $4,999 – $5,399
    BMW F 750 GS $10,000 – $12,000
    Honda CB650R $8,000 – $9,000
    Yamaha MT-07 $7,699 – $8,200
    Kawasaki Z900 $8,199 – $9,199
    BMW R 1250 GS Adventure $20,000 – $25,000
    Harley-Davidson Road King $20,000 – $25,000

    All brands offer a variety of models that cater to different riding styles, and you may find that entry-level and mid-range motorcycles are competitively priced. High-end models, however, often feature premium builds and advanced technology that justify their higher costs.
